Your mission: 

Join an established, dynamic HR team on a fixed-term contract until 31st October 2026. Your mission is to provide practical HR support to line managers and employees across Europe, ensuring smooth administration processes and delivering a consistently high level of service.

This role offers the opportunity to work within a fast-paced, international organisation, supporting employees and managers across the UK&I, CEE and Nordics. You will also assist in implementing local and European HR projects that enhance efficiency and employee experience.

What you will do:

  • Deliver HR administrative support across the full employee lifecycle, escalating complex issues to senior HR colleagues or relevant specialists.
  • Provide excellent employee experience via Case Management technology, MS Teams calls and face to face interactions
  • Manage onboarding processes and maintain accurate HR systems and records.
  • Coordinate training workshops and support learning initiatives.
  • Support European benefits administration and local wellbeing activities.
  • Contribute to local HR projects and ensure alignment with EMEAR policies and practices, working with HR teams across Europe.
  • Support our HR Advisors in note taking for employee relations meetings
  • Produce metrics and reporting to validate and improve management decisions

What we ask for:

  • Previous experience in an HR administrative or support role.
  • Understanding of HR processes and local employment regulations.
  • Strong organisational skills with attention to detail and accuracy.
  • Good communication skills and a helpful, collaborative approach.
  • Comfortable using MS Office applications; experience with HR systems is an advantage.
  • Ability to manage multiple tasks and meet deadlines.
  • Flexible and proactive attitude with a willingness to learn.
  • Good level of English, additional European languages would be an advantage
